Summary

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School is a public middle school serving grades 6-8 in the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Central School District, located in Ravena, NY. The school has 393 students and is ranked 659 out of 874 in New York, with a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School consistently underperforms compared to the state average and its own district average on New York State Assessments in English Language Arts, Math, and Science. For example, in 2024-2025, the school's proficiency rates were 43.12% in 6th grade ELA, 40.78% in 7th grade ELA, and 33.33% in 8th grade ELA, compared to the state averages of 50.86%, 50.99%, and 52.38% respectively. The school's performance is particularly low for certain student subgroups, ranking in the bottom 25% of NY middle schools for White students, Multi-racial students, Special Education students, and Low Socioeconomic Status students in both ELA and Math.

When compared to nearby middle schools, such as Farnsworth Middle School in the Guilderland Central School District,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School significantly underperforms across all subject areas and grade levels on state assessments. However, the school's Regents exam performance is strong, with 100% proficiency rates in Earth Science and Algebra I in recent years, suggesting a disconnect between the school's performance on state assessments and its ability to prepare students for advanced coursework.

Frequently Asked Questions about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School

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School ranks 937th of 1500 New York middle schools. SchoolDigger rates this school 2 stars out of 5.

Students who attend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School usually go on to attend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Senior High School

Students at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School are 78% White, 10% Hispanic, 7% Two or more races, 3% African American, 1% Asian.

In the 2024-25 school year, 375 students attended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k Middle School.
